Imam Sadiq (A.S.)'s note to his followers
By: Sayyed Ebadi Hayat
Presenting this note of Imam Ja’fer As-Sadeq (A.S.) on
Shawal 15 which marks his anniversary of martyrdom … Imam (A.S.) was
martyred by poisoning by the Abbasid caliph Mansur in holy Madinah -
city of Prophet (S.A.W.). He was buried at Baqi' graveyard, beside his
father, grandfather, father’s uncle grandfather, and grandmother
Sayyedah Fatima Az-Zahra' (A.S.).
Ask Allah for good health. Adhere to courtesy, decorum and
tranquility, and promote yourselves against what the virtuous ones
among you promote themselves against.
Remark favorably on the wrong people: be steadfast against their
oppression, beware of opposing them, and use taqiyyah of which Allah
ordered you when you sit, associate, and discuss with them. You have
to sit, associate, and discuss with them, They will surely hurt you if
they notice that you deny their beliefs. They will surely subjugate
you unless Allah protect you against them. Their hearts bear malice
and hatred against you more than what they show.
The servant that Allah created as faithful believer will not die
before he hates and goes away from evil. He whom Allah causes to hate
and go away from evil will be saved from arrogance and pride. Hence,
his mannerism and features will be well and his face will be smiling.
He will acquire the decorum, tranquility, and reverence of Islam, keep
himself away from matters that Allah forbids, and evade matters that
enrage Allah. Moreover, Allah will endow him with people's affection
and courtesy and save him from boycotting people and engaging in
disputations.
The servant that Allah created him as disbeliever will not die before
he loves and favors evil. He whom Allah causes to love and favor evil
will be arrogant and proud. Hence, he will be hard-hearted, vicious,
rude-faced, famed of vulgarity, and shameless. Allah will dishonor him
as nothing will prevent him from committing the prohibited matters and
the acts of disobedience to Allah. He will hate obedience to Allah and
its people. Far away are the believers' manners from the
disbelievers'.
Ask Allah for good health and seek it from Him. All power and might
belong to Allah.
Supplicate to Allah very frequently. He loves the servants who
supplicate to Him. He promised them of response. On the Day of
Resurrection, Allah will change the believers' supplications into
deeds due to which their ranks of Paradise will be added. Refer to
Allah very much in every hour of every day and night. He ordered to
mention Him frequently and He will mention the believers who mention
Him. Allah will remember graciously every believer who mentions Him.
Keep up the prayers in general and the middle prayer in specific, and
stand up while offering prayers in obedience to Allah, as Allah
ordered the faithful believers before you in His Book.
You should love the poor Muslims. He whoever debases and humbles them
will deviate from Allah's religion and Allah will debase him. Our
father the Prophet (S.A.W.) said; My Lord ordered me to love the poor
Muslims." You must know that Allah will throw hatred and belittlement
upon him whoever humiliates any of the Muslims, so that people will
hate him intensely. Fear Allah in regard to the poor Muslims; your
brothers. It is obligatory upon you to love them since Allah ordered
His Prophet (S.A.W.) to love them. He whoever dislikes those whom
Allah ordered His Prophet (S.A.W.) to love is disobeying Allah and His
messenger. He who disobeys Allah and His Messenger to death will be
reckoned as one of those who returned into a rebel.
Beware of pride and arrogance, because arrogance is Allah's dress, and
He will surely subdue and humiliate him whoever tries to take His
dress.
Beware of oppressing each other, because this is not a character of
the virtuous. Allah will make the results of any oppression against
the originator of that oppression and will give His victory to the
wronged party. He whom is given Allah's victory will surely overcome
and prosper.
Beware of envying each other, because it is the origin of atheism.
Beware of standing against the wronged Muslim, because Allah will
respond to him when he supplicates to him. Our father the Prophet (S.A.W.)
said: The supplication of the wronged Muslim is responded."
Beware of desiring for anything that Allah forbids. Allah will deprive
those who violate the prohibited matters of Paradise and its
pleasures, delights, and everlasting awards.
